黑狐家游戏

数据库集群共享存储的必要性及实现策略探讨,数据库集群需要共享存储吗对吗

欧气 0 0

本文目录导读:

数据库集群共享存储的必要性及实现策略探讨,数据库集群需要共享存储吗对吗

图片来源于网络,如有侵权联系删除

  1. 数据库集群共享存储的必要性
  2. 数据库集群共享存储的实现策略

随着互联网技术的飞速发展,企业对数据库集群的需求日益增长,数据库集群能够提高数据存储和处理能力,满足大规模数据的应用需求,在构建数据库集群的过程中,是否需要共享存储成为了业界关注的焦点,本文将从数据库集群共享存储的必要性、实现策略等方面进行探讨。

数据库集群共享存储的必要性

1、提高数据一致性

在数据库集群中,共享存储可以保证数据的一致性,当多个节点需要访问同一份数据时,共享存储能够确保所有节点访问的是同一份数据副本,避免了数据不一致的问题。

2、提高数据可用性

共享存储可以提高数据库集群的数据可用性,当某个节点发生故障时,其他节点可以继续访问共享存储中的数据,保证了系统的正常运行。

3、提高系统扩展性

共享存储可以方便地实现数据库集群的横向扩展,当集群需要增加节点时,只需将新节点接入共享存储,即可实现数据的同步和扩展。

数据库集群共享存储的必要性及实现策略探讨,数据库集群需要共享存储吗对吗

图片来源于网络,如有侵权联系删除

4、降低运维成本

共享存储可以降低数据库集群的运维成本,由于所有节点访问的是同一份数据,因此可以减少数据备份、恢复等运维工作的复杂度。

数据库集群共享存储的实现策略

1、分布式文件系统

分布式文件系统(DFS)是一种常见的共享存储解决方案,DFS可以将数据分散存储在多个节点上,通过网络实现数据访问和同步,常见的DFS有HDFS、Ceph等。

2、共享存储阵列

共享存储阵列(SAN)是一种高性能、高可靠性的存储解决方案,SAN通过光纤通道或以太网连接存储设备和服务器,实现数据的高速传输和共享,常见的SAN产品有EMC、NetApp等。

3、共享文件系统

数据库集群共享存储的必要性及实现策略探讨,数据库集群需要共享存储吗对吗

图片来源于网络,如有侵权联系删除

共享文件系统(NFS、SMB)是一种基于网络的文件共享方案,通过NFS或SMB协议,服务器可以将文件系统共享给其他节点,实现数据访问和同步。

4、分布式数据库集群

分布式数据库集群(如Apache Cassandra、Amazon DynamoDB)本身就是一种共享存储解决方案,通过分布式存储和计算,数据库集群可以提供高可用性、高性能的数据存储和处理能力。

数据库集群共享存储对于提高数据一致性、可用性、系统扩展性和降低运维成本具有重要意义,在实际应用中,可以根据企业需求选择合适的共享存储实现策略,随着技术的不断发展,共享存储方案将更加多样化,为数据库集群的发展提供有力支持。

标签: #数据库集群需要共享存储吗

黑狐家游戏
  • 评论列表

留言评论